In developing the product range for hazardous environments, Konecranes utilized its vast experience in explosion-proof applications, extensive resources and innovation in crane and component technology. This has resulted in the most competitive and comprehensive range of explosion-proof cranes and components. The range includes industrial cranes, jib cranes and manual cranes as well as electric and manual hoists with lifting capacities from 125 kg to 100 tons. All the components are designed and manufactured to ensure the highest safety level required for hazardous atmospheres in chemical and petrochemical plants, oil refineries, gas power plants, waste water treatment plants, paint shops and other industrial sites.
Safety comes first – Regulations and standards
New ATE X directives adopted by the European Union became mandatory on July 1, 2003. Konecranes cranes and components are designed to meet the new ATE X directives. Konecranes products also comply with the European explosion-proof standards such as EN60079- 0 /-1 /-7/-11/-15. Components are type tested by approved independent Notified Bodies and all products are provided with CE marking and documentation. Konecranes EX components can be supplied with additional IECE X certificate.
EXN Electric Chain Hoist for Hazardous Environments
Konecranes’ EXN electric chain hoist family for hazardous environments is designed to meet the requirements of the user’s application.
The EXN hoist is available as stationary, hook suspended, push and motorized trolley versions. Special low headroom trolley for Supersackhandling is available as well.
